Output b84bc6b1a081bf9b526b529f9151e143cbf4c665b65f6b8d09d86c2f04b13c09:3

value
31320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 716fc63ee468acb056fe8f360d85295a0b06964f OP_EQUAL
address
3C2pBSafENqxyuRtKBASL3XcwV2x8o65cG
transaction
b84bc6b1a081bf9b526b529f9151e143cbf4c665b65f6b8d09d86c2f04b13c09
spent
true